Dubai's reputation in decline/ The city of luxury's luster fades

The war in Iran has brought consequences for the entire world, but the most critical ones have been felt by neighboring countries that were once considered paradises on earth.

The conflict has led to an exodus of wealthy individuals, tarnishing Dubai's reputation as a haven for the global elite and a city synonymous with luxury. 

Dubai has empty shopping malls, deserted streets and hotels that have halved their prices or closed down altogether. One of the latter is the Burj Al Arab hotel, famous worldwide for its sailboat-shaped design. The hotel's reservations department said the hotels are closing for a year for "renovations." 

Prices have fallen and luxury hotels now offer stays at prices comparable to low-cost hotels in Europe.

The Park Hyatt Dubai is facing empty rooms and possible staff cuts. At another luxury hotel, Raffles Dubai, there is also minimal occupancy.

The closure of the Strait of Hormuz is another cause that has led to lighter traffic, reduced tourist activity and delays in relocation plans, along with the departures of some high-net-worth residents from Dubai.

Real estate deals have been put on hold and many foreigners are starting to question staying in Dubai for long periods of time.

Even if missile and drone attacks stop, the ongoing danger of a hostile Iran will continue to pose a serious threat to regional stability. /CNA
